{"version":1,"type":"rich","provider_name":"Libsyn","provider_url":"https:\/\/www.libsyn.com","height":90,"width":600,"title":"Resuscitation vs Resurrection","description":"           Jesus raised Lazarus from the grave, but Lazarus was not transformed. He was still mortal, subject to the curse, and destined to die again. In other words, Lazarus was resuscitated; he was not truly resurrected. This message contrasts the difference between being rescued by God and being reborn, and asks whether we have accepted a lesser gospel of mere resuscitation when the life we are called to is one of transformation possible through the power of Christ's resurrection.         &amp;nbsp;       ","author_name":"Chicago Fellowship Talks","author_url":"https:\/\/chicagofellowship.com","html":"<iframe title=\"Libsyn Player\" style=\"border: none\" src=\"\/\/html5-player.libsyn.com\/embed\/episode\/id\/41299150\/height\/90\/theme\/custom\/thumbnail\/yes\/direction\/forward\/render-playlist\/no\/custom-color\/c1272d\/\" height=\"90\" width=\"600\" scrolling=\"no\"  allowfullscreen webkitallowfullscreen mozallowfullscreen oallowfullscreen msallowfullscreen><\/iframe>","thumbnail_url":"https:\/\/assets.libsyn.com\/secure\/item\/41299150"}
